On this day in the Civil War, General U. S. Grant replaces General William Rosecrans with General George Thomas as head of the Army of the Cumberland. Grant’s decision is based on Rosecran’s handling of the Battle of Chickamauga and its aftermath.
President Lincoln commented that he (Rosecrans) acted “confused and stunned, like a duck hit on the head.”
